课设&大作业&毕设&基于SSM使用idea构建的旅游网站---毕业设计.zip
2.虚拟产品一经售出概不退款(资源遇到问题,请及时私信上传者)
中的“课设&大作业&毕设”表明这是一个学习项目,可能是大学课程的实践环节,如课程设计、大型作业或毕业设计。而“基于SSM使用idea构建的旅游网站”则揭示了项目的核心内容,即使用Spring、SpringMVC和MyBatis(SSM)框架,在IntelliJ IDEA集成开发环境中开发一个旅游网站。 部分进一步确认了项目是关于“基于SSM使用idea构建的旅游网站”的毕业设计,这通常意味着学生在毕业前的最后一个项目,旨在综合运用所学的计算机科学和软件工程知识,特别是Java Web开发技术。 再次强调了这个项目的性质,它是教学过程中的实践部分,可能涉及团队协作和个人技能展示。 【压缩包子文件的文件名称列表】中的"bysjbysjfdadfadfaf55555"看起来像是一个随机生成的临时文件名,可能是项目源代码、数据库脚本、文档或其他资源的压缩包。由于名称不明确,具体包含的内容无法直接解读,但可以推断它应该包含了实现旅游网站所需的所有文件和资料。 在这个基于SSM的旅游网站项目中,学生可能需要掌握以下知识点: 1. **Spring框架**:Spring是一个全面的Java企业级应用开发框架,提供了依赖注入(DI)、面向切面编程(AOP)、事务管理等核心功能,以及对其他框架的集成支持。 2. **SpringMVC**:Spring的Web MVC模块,用于处理HTTP请求,实现Model-View-Controller(MVC)架构模式,帮助开发者创建高效、灵活的Web应用程序。 3. **MyBatis**:是一个持久层框架,它允许开发者编写SQL语句,将数据库操作与业务逻辑分离,提供灵活的映射机制,便于数据访问。 4. **IntelliJ IDEA**:一款强大的Java IDE,拥有丰富的代码补全、调试和重构功能,对于SSM项目的开发非常友好。 5. **Web开发基础**:包括HTML、CSS、JavaScript等前端技术,以及Servlet、JSP等后端技术,用于构建用户界面和处理动态请求。 6. **数据库设计**:可能使用MySQL、Oracle等关系型数据库,需要理解ER模型、范式理论,以及SQL查询语言。 7. **Maven或Gradle**:构建工具,用于管理项目依赖、构建和打包应用。 8. **版本控制**:如Git,用于协同开发和版本管理。 9. **RESTful API设计**:用于前后端分离,提供HTTP接口供客户端调用。 10. **单元测试和集成测试**:如JUnit、Mockito等,确保代码质量和功能的正确性。 11. **安全性考虑**:包括用户认证、授权、防止SQL注入和跨站脚本攻击等。 12. **项目文档**:如需求分析、设计文档、用户手册等,记录项目的全过程和细节。 通过这个项目,学生将有机会全面了解和实践Web开发流程,从需求分析、系统设计、编码实现到测试和部署,提升自己的实际操作能力和问题解决能力。
- 1
- 2
- 3
- 粉丝: 172
- 资源: 2460
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- 美国旧金山28R粗糙跑道数据
- Java编程语言详解与实战指南:从基础到进阶
- 车辆,汽车检测1-YOLO(v5至v11)、COCO、CreateML、Paligemma、TFRecord、VOC数据集合集.rar
- 六轴,scara机器人运动学分析,建模和运动控制 matlab,simulink,simscape.机器人工具箱,DH建模 Pd控制,滑模控制,模糊控制等等
- 课程设计-花卉识别源代码
- “如何帮助缺乏学习动力的小孩子”主题讲座.pptx
- “青少年心理健康”讲座.pptx
- “遵守交通规则,安全出行”知识讲座.pptx
- “师德师风教育”培训讲座教案.pptx
- 如何阅读分享一本书讲座课件.pptx
- 开学第一课“收心主题班会”教案.pptx
- 初中语文开学第一课“走近语文 魅力无穷”.pptx
- LLC全桥仿真方案 用的是数字控制方式 psim软件,可以很直观的学习认识各个位置波形 通过调整PI参数来调试电源 尤其对初学者帮助很大 同时包含mathcad计算
- Python从入门到精通:基础知识与高级应用全面解析
- 储能选址定容,33节点,matpower潮流计算,计算目标函数 考虑储能SOC、储能额定容量、功率约束 NSGA2多目标:储能投资费用和电压偏差最小 熵权TOPSIS确定最优解
- Swift编程语言全面教程:从入门到精通